Overview of Cedar Creek Assisted Living

Cedar Creek Assisted Living is a 78-bed facility providing standard residential assistance, memory care, and short-term respite stays. The property provides dining services, housekeeping, laundry, a shared outdoor rocking porch, and a calendar of group exercise, crafts, games, and social outings. Staffing includes 24-hour personnel with nursing support, and the community accommodates diverse funding structures by accepting private insurance, HMO plans, Medicaid, and Veterans Affairs benefits. The location is car-dependent, with a Walk Score of 1.

State regulatory summaries tracking 69 separate inspections from June 2012 through September 2025 document 128 total line-item infractions over the property’s operational timeline. This cumulative frequency runs significantly above the standard Florida average, and because 67 of those 69 regulatory reviews resulted in at least one initial citation, the home carries a low long-term zero citations-per-inspection rate for absolute perfection.

Multi-year compliance logs note persistent challenges across several domains, including resident supervision, medication handling, admissions contracts, staff training records, emergency planning, and background screening clearances, resulting in 16 administrative fines totaling $23,000.

Care Types in This Table AL (Assisted Living): Housing with help for daily activities like bathing, dressing, and medication, without 24-hour skilled nursing. MC (Memory Care): Secured, specialized care for people living with Alzheimer's or dementia. RC (Respite Care): Short-term temporary care that gives family caregivers a break. IL (Independent Living): Community living with dining, activities, and transportation for active seniors who need little personal care. ADC (Adult Day Care): Daytime supervision, health monitoring, and social activities for seniors who live at home.

Long-Term Care Waiver

Florida Medicaid LTC Waiver

Age 65+ or 21+ disabled
General Florida resident, Medicaid- eligible, nursing home-level care need.
Income Limits (2025) ~$2,829/month 300% FBR, individual
Asset Limits $2,000 (individual), $3,000 (couple).
FL

High demand; waitlists common.

Benefits
In-home care (6-8 hours/day) Assisted living Respite (240 hours/year) Case management

Community Care for the Elderly (CCE)

Florida CCE

Age 60+
General Florida resident, at risk of nursing home.
Income Limits ~$2,000/month varies
Asset Limits $5,000 individual
FL

Limited funding; regional variation.

Benefits
Homemaker services (3-5 hours/week) Adult day care (~$60/day) Respite (up to 10 days/year)

Program of All-Inclusive Care for the Elderly (PACE)

Florida Medicaid PACE

Age 55+
General Florida resident, nursing home-level care need, safe with PACE support.
Income Limits (2025) ~$2,829/month 300% FBR
Asset Limits $2,000 (individual), $3,000 (couple).
FL

Limited to specific counties (e.g., Hillsborough, Miami-Dade); ~10 sites statewide.

Benefits
Personal care (5-7 hours/day) Medical care Meals Transportation Therapy
